LAURENS POV

I wiped down the bar exchanging tired glances with my co-worker as the night wound down at the Black Cat.

"Long shift" my colleague remarked eyeing the emptying room.

"Tell me about it" I replied nodding towards the clock ticking past midnight. "Time to call it a night."

As I bid farewell to my colleague and stepped out onto the dimly lit street a warning drifted after me. "Be careful out there Lauren Gotham's not the safest at this hour."

I laughed a hollow chuckle born from the routine of the caution. "Isn't it every night?"

The familiar path home took me through the shadowy alleys and quiet streets of Gotham. 

With each step the feeling of being watched lingered at the edges of my senses. 

I glanced around but the darkness held no secrets no lurking figures in its depths.

Finally reaching the dinged-up apartment I called home I purchased at 19.

I stepped inside greeted by the warm glow of fairy lights I had strung across the room. 

It was a modest space but it held a homely charm—a haven I had fashioned from the earnings I'd saved up scrupulously accumulated during my time at Pennies.

The walls were adorned with posters and mementos each telling a snippet of my journey.

 A well-loved couch sat a few feet from  the window offering a view of the city's skyline from the old rickety metal fire exit stairs that adorn the back of the building.

 The kitchen though small boasted a comforting aroma of spices and warmth custom to my fire hazard obsession called candles.

After a hot shower to wash away the remnants of the night I settled onto the couch flicking on a movie to unwind. 

Time seemed to blur scenes passing in a familiar dance of comfort and distraction.

Suddenly a loud thud echoed from the apartment above jolting me from my reverie.

 It was a regular occurrence these late-night disturbances but tonight it grated on my nerves more than usual.

"This has got to stop" I muttered to myself frustration tinged with exhaustion. 

I'd had enough of the constant disruptions the lack of consideration from the neighbors.


I stormed up the stairs the frustration from the persistent disruptions fueling my determination to resolve the issue once and for all. 

My knuckles rapped against the door in a firm but deliberate rhythm.

A few moments passed before the door cracked open revealing a disheveled figure on the other side.

piercing green eyes met mine with a mix of confusion and annoyance.

"What do you want?" His voice held an edge a demand rather than a question.

"Look I live  below number 15 and the noise—" I began my tone sharper than intended a response to his abruptness.

Before I could finish my request a sudden noise of pain emanated from the man behind the door. 

It caught me off guard a momentary pause in my annoyance as concern flickered through me.

"Are you okay?" I started to ask but before I could complete the question he interrupted.

"Sorry ill keep it down in the future" he muttered his tone softer now an unexpected shift from the earlier hostility.

I hesitated taken aback by the sudden change in his demeanor. 

His expression softened an unspoken apology in his eyes before he closed the door with a finality that left me standing there bewildered.

The encounter left me feeling perplexed  an unexpected twist in what I had anticipated to be a confrontation.

 The man's reaction had been abrupt yet tinged with a hint of pain or discomfort leaving me with more questions than answers as I descended the stairs back to my apartment.

The persistent disturbances upstairs had abated for the night replaced by a lingering curiosity about the enigmatic neighbor above a mystery that seemed to deepen with every passing moment.

The days passed with a surprising quietness the disturbances from the apartment above reduced to occasional muffled thuds that hardly disturbed the peace.

 It was a welcome change a sense of tranquility settling over my little sanctuary.

it was late afternoon  when I had decided sporadically decide to enjoy the fading sunlight with a jog around the neighborhood. 

The rhythmic pounding of my footsteps provided a soothing soundtrack as I traversed the familiar streets of Gotham.

Mid-stride my phone buzzed with an incoming call  the screen flashing 'Bruce Wayne.' 

The unexpected caller caught me off guard but I answered curious about the reason for his reach out.

"Hello Lauren  I hope I'm not interrupting anything," his smooth voice resonated through the line.

"Not at all Bruce what can I help you with ?" I replied trying to keep my tone polite but guarded.

"I wanted to extend an invitation Would you be interested in joining us for dinner at the manor this evening? Alfred Tim and I would love to catch up, he offered.

"I understand if you have other commitments" Bruce added sensing my  slight hesitation.

The invitation took me by surprise but the prospect of dinner with Bruce Wayne and his company intrigued me.

 "Yes I'd love too thank you for inviting me I'll  stop by though I might have to leave early as I have work " I accepted keeping my response friendly yet guarded.

As the call ended I continued my run the evening sky painting hues of orange and pink as the sun began its descent. 

The prospect of dinner at Wayne Manor added an unexpected twist to an otherwise uneventful day

<><><><><><><><<><<><><><<><><><><><><><><><><><><><><>

later that evening 


As I arrived at Wayne Manor Alfred greeted me  at the door with his customary warmth.

 There was an undeniable bond between us something that transcended mere formality.

 A smile lit up my face as I embraced him in a hug his presence a comforting familiarity in the grandeur of the manor.

"Miss Lauren it's always a delight to see you" Alfred said returning the embrace.

 His genuine affection was a testament to the connection we shared.

"How many times Alfred just Lauren is fine" I chuckle at the comment I seem to constantly revisit when seeing Alfred.

" My apologies mis..." Alfred pauses and shakes his head in amusement " Lauren" he gives me a soft smile.

As we walked together towards the dining room I caught sight of Bruce Wayne and a young man seated beside him.

 The young man Tim Drake was dressed in a smart but understated ensemble  a casual elegance that seemed to echo the air of confidence in his demeanor. 

It was hard to ignore the fact that he now donned the mantle of the new Robin.

Tim Drake had become Bruce's protégé after deducing the identities of Bruce as batman  and Jason as robin .

 Despite my initial reservations I couldn't help but feel protective towards Tim. 

The fear of history repeating itself the tragedy that had befallen Jason lingered in the back of my mind. 

However over time I'd come to regard Tim with a cautious fondness a mix of protectiveness and wariness  much like a sister might feel.

Bruce hadn't changed much since the day we first met if anything, he seemed wearier burdened by the weight of his responsibilities.

 He rose to greet me his demeanor unchanged a blend of cordiality and an underlying distance.

"Good to see you, Lauren," Bruce acknowledged his tone polite but distant.

"Likewise Bruce" I replied a congenial smile masking the internal conflict.

 Bruce's presence still held a weight for me—a blend of respect admiration and the lingering burden of blame I carried for Jason's death. 

It was a silent conflict within me, one that simmered beneath the surface unspoken but ever-present.

Inside I grappled with the complexities of our relationship.

 I respected Bruce and considered him a part of my extended  albeit unconventional family. 

Yet there remained an unspoken divide—a layer of blame I held over his choices a feeling that whispered of missed guidance and protection for Jason.

And in the private recesses of my thoughts I couldn't shake the profound guilt I harbored an unyielding self-blame for Jason's fate. 

Despite the outward politeness these emotions churned within hidden beneath a composed facade.

As the evening drew to a close I made my way towards the door, bidding farewell to Bruce Alfred and Tim. 


The goodbyes were polite but tinged with an unspoken undercurrent a mixture of warmth and the lingering weight of unresolved emotions.

Alfred's parting words held a genuine warmth his eyes reflecting a deep-seated affection as he said "Take care, Miss Lauren. You're always welcome here."

Tim's voice broke through the atmosphere a hint of eagerness mixed with a touch of uncertainty. "Hey, Lauren, do you think you could come back sometime? Help me with the Bat computer? You have experience with this stuff."

His request caught me off guard, but I nodded, a sense of responsibility and camaraderie softening my demeanor. "Sure Tim.... I'll come by.... Ill do what I can to help."

With a final wave I left Wayne Manor the grandeur of the estate fading behind me as I stepped out into the night. 

The air was crisp a contrast to the complexity of emotions that swirled within me.
